Accommodation Description
Swartberg Manor is a peaceful getaway into a world of calm, beauty and tranquility, situated at the foot of the Swartberg Mountains in the Klein Karoo region of the Western Cape. With an incredible home away from home feel, Swartberg Country Manor offers guests a scenic space to enjoy the natural beauty of the Klein Karoo in oasis-style comfort.
Swartberg Country Manor offers a variety of accommodations suited to families, small groups, or couples travelling the region. These include 25 comfortable en-suite guest rooms, the four-roomed Historical House overlooking a fig orchard, the 11-roomed stylish Main House offers 11 with breathtaking panoramic mountain views from the open lounge, and a further nine Karoo-style cottages plus a romantic honeymoon suite. The getaway also features a large swimming pool and lovely on-site restaurant.
Setting Description
The Klein Karoo in South Africa is a stunning valley that extends for about 350 kilometers, running from Montagu in the western region to Uniondale in the east. It is enveloped by majestic mountains, with the Swartberg Mountains to the north and the unbroken Langeberge and Outeniqua Mountains to the south, encompassing all of the famed Route 62 travellers route.
Swartberg Country Manor is situated on the farm “Voorbedacht” located in the Cango Valley, at the foot of the world-renowned Swartberg Mountain Pass. For those looking to explore the surroundings, the farm offers the ideal base to visit the nearby Cango Caves, hiking or mountain bike trails, the Swartberg Pass itself and many other historical points of interest.
